MUM-TO-BE Glenda Gilson, left, looked stunning at the Virgin Media autumn launch at the Aviva Stadium. Wearing a Kooples dress with Gucci trainers Glenda was seen protective­ly rubbing her growing bump. She said: ‘We don’t know what we are having, we decided not to find out. We have chosen some boys and girls names and they are very normal.’ The presenter is due in October and will be back to work in November as host of Ireland’s Got More Talent.

HER TV show is named after her and Elaine Crowley’s eponymous range of dresses, Elaine, by So Couture is set for launch next month. She debuted a little number from the collection this week, saying: ‘This is one of the designs and I’m very proud of them.’ The chat show host, above, has already started on her second collection which will be a range of tops. Life is tops all round for Elaine as things with long-term boyfriend Keith are ‘going great’.
